<p>I was able to see a total of 4 games at the Christmas Crossover this year and here are the prospects who stood out in those games.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">Noah Kon</span> 6'0 PG / Houston Christian / Jr. <a href="https://prephoops.com/texas/rankings/2021-rankings/"><span style="color: #ff6600;">PH</span><span style="color: #ffcc00;">TX</span><span style="color: #ff0000;">100</span></a></strong></p> <p>Noah had himself a big game as he went for another 30 point outburst. He is a bouncy guard whose jump shot continues to get better from beyond the arc throughout the season. He has a great motor and plays a little bully ball as he is able to get where he wants on the floor. Had some back-scratching dunks in the game that got the crowd going crazy. He is one that college coaches should have on their radar.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">Derrick Brown III</span> 6'0 G / St. Pius X / Sr.</strong></p> <p>Derrick has a quick release on his jumper. He doesn't get much lift on his shot but he makes them at a high rate. Has good ball speed and is very competitive on the court. Filled the right lanes while pushing it in transition for great looks for his teammates.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">Jaylen Wysinger</span> 6'1 PG / St. Pius X / Jr.</strong></p> <p>This bouncy prospect plays with a super high motor. He has the ability to create his own shot at will no matter how tough the defense may be. He showed flashes of his point guard abilities as a passer throughout the game as well with quality paint touches for easy kick-outs to his teammates. He is a prospect that coaches want to get to know as well as he can fill up the stat sheet really quick.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">Tyler Jackson</span> 6'5 SF / Nederland / Jr. </strong></p> <p>I've said it before and I will say it again about this prospect and that is he is a junkyard dawg. He rebounds the ball extremely well by boxing out on every possession and out jumping his opponent. Plays with great energy and just gets after it. Aways shots at a high rate with quality buckets by driving and finishing over bigger defenders. Takes charges and doesn't say much just plays the game. Finished with 31 points and 9 rebounds. Solid prospect that coaches at the D2 level want to get to know ASAP.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">Hayden Hefner</span> 6'4 SG / Nederland / Sr. <a href="https://prephoops.com/texas/rankings/2020-rankings/"><span style="color: #ff6600;">PH</span><span style="color: #ffcc00;">TX</span><span style="color: #ff0000;">200</span></a> <span style="color: #800000;">[Texas A&amp;M]</span></strong></p> <p>It took Hefner a while to get going but once his shots started to fall he was as good as gold. Finished with 21 points in the game on 4/10-3PT shooting. The Aggies commit played the majority of the game and also dished out 6 assists in the game. He isn't 100% healthy yet but he looked good on the court.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">RJ Keene</span> 6'4 SG / Concordia Lutheran / Jr.<a href="https://prephoops.com/texas/rankings/2021-rankings/"> <span style="color: #ff6600;">PH</span><span style="color: #ffcc00;">TX</span><span style="color: #ff0000;">100</span></a></strong></p> <p>RJ made some really tough jumpers in the game. Showcased his off-ball game with solid catch and shoot plays with great elevation and a quick release. His game continues to mature throughout the season. He currently holds a pair of NCAA D1 offers on the table and next season when he's a senior he will be putting everyone in the rim trust me on this one. He finished with 21 points and 7 rebounds in the game.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">D'Avian Houston</span> 6'2 PG / Episcopal / Sr. <a href="https://prephoops.com/texas/rankings/2020-rankings/"><span style="color: #ff6600;">PH</span><span style="color: #ffcc00;">TX</span><span style="color: #ff0000;">200</span></a> <span style="color: #800000;">[College of Charleston]</span></strong></p> <p>D-A was in his bag as a point in the game that I saw him. The College of Charleton commit was making some great full-court outlets into easy buckets under the rim and breaking down the half-court defense as well to get his teammates involved in the game. His ability to break down the defense also led him to some easy baskets at the rim where he finished the game with 15 points, 6 assists, and 5 rebounds.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">DJ Nussbaum</span> 6'9 C / Episcopal / Sr. <a href="https://prephoops.com/texas/rankings/2020-rankings/"><span style="color: #ff6600;">PH</span><span style="color: #ffcc00;">TX</span><span style="color: #ff0000;">200</span></a> <span style="color: #993300;">[VMI]</span></strong></p> <p>The Virginia Military Institute commit looked really solid in his game. He showcased great hands in the post. Solid skill set on the low block and short corner. Finished with both hands around the rim. Was solid on both sides off the ball in the pick-n-roll/pick-n-pop sets. Finished the game with 20 points and 8 rebounds. </p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p><strong><span style="color: #ff6600;">JaQuan Scott</span> 6'8 PF / Universal Academy / Sr. <a href="https://prephoops.com/texas/rankings/2020-rankings/"><span style="color: #ff6600;">PH</span><span style="color: #ffcc00;">TX</span><span style="color: #ff0000;">200</span></a></strong></p> <p>Jaquan was on a mission from the tip of the game. The mission was to dominate the entire game and he did it with ease. He had a nasty posterizing dunk that made it's way to Overtime and went viral online. Currently holds an NCAA Divison 1 offer from St. Johns University. He was looking more like a Point Foward as he brought the ball up the floor and ran the show on multiple possessions. Big time motor who did it all in the game. </p>
